GE Vernova – Grid Systems Integration product line is globally recognized for designing, manufacturing, and delivering customized High Voltage Direct Current (HVDC) solutions for utilities worldwide. With over 130 years of pioneering experience, GE offers two HVDC technologies, Line Commutated Converters (LCC) and Voltage Source Converters (VSC), to support a broad range of applications and deployable in different schemes including overhead line (point to point), back-to-back, submarine/land cable and offshore.
Every HVDC solution is tailored and designed based on a project-by-project assessment of the customers' individual requirements, whether it's for connecting offshore wind generation, long distance power transmission, or energy trading between independent networks.

Roles and Responsibilities

Specific Role Requirements:

  • HV (Primary) designs for 132 kV and above GIS/AIS Substation Engineering for Grid Interconnected Projects
  • Preparation of basic Single Line Diagram, Layout Plan & Section of Overall plant, Equipment control room, Earthing Layout, DSLP Layout, Trench Layout etc
  • Earthing design, Lightning design, Cable Sizing, Battery Sizing, Illumination system design, Sag Tension calculation, Short Circuit Force and Bus- bar Sizing as per IEEE/IEC.
  • Project related all Equipment Selection/ Sizing as per IEEE/IEC
  • Ensure proper implementation of plant engineering process
  • Convert project contractual documents into plant engineering requirements,
  • Define and/or control plant engineering planning for the project ensuring on-time delivery,
  • Release plant engineering deliverables as per project planning & cost without non-conformity,
  • Support plant engineering planning and cost estimation for the project
  • Lead the plant engineers for the assigned project(s) (functional reports)
  • Lead the design optimized substation & buildings layouts integrating all the required equipment considering their installation, operation, and maintenance constraints,
  • Interface with other disciplines
  • Answer to client, partners & suppliers technical queries related to plant engineering,
  • Organize and perform projects design/gate reviews related to plant engineering & support other disciplines’ ones when required.
  • Lead change control impacting plant engineering deliverables & activities,
  • Evaluation of vendor Drawings, GTP, Calculation & Technical Specs
  • ITO (tender) drawings, BOQ estimation, RFQ finalization & evaluation of various components, selection of equipment with best pricing options.
  • Co-ordination and integration with Automation, Civil & MEP.
  • Co-ordination of site & office team for execution of project
  • Flexible and quick to learn global developments in renewable technologies and adopt.
  • Knowhow of IEEE / IEC codes, safety in design/EHS aspects, AC substation industry engineering practices.
  • Good Communication skills & capability to lead project independently along with Client handling.
  • Team handling & development.

GE Vernova's Grid Solutions business electrifies the world by delivering advanced grid technologies that enable efficient power transmission and distribution from generation to consumption. With a global footprint of 14,000 employees in around 80 countries, Grid Solutions serves 90% of the world’s power utilities, supporting a reliable, efficient, and decarbonized energy transition.


Grid Solutions offers a wide range of products and services, including power electronics, high voltage equipment, automation & protection systems, software solutions, and turnkey projects, Grid Solutions also provides consulting, electrical balance of plant, E/HHV substations, and comprehensive maintenance and asset management services.

GE Vernova’s businesses provide products and services through its Power, Wind and Electrification segments. The Power segment consists of Gas Power, Nuclear Power, Hydro Power, and Steam Power, the Wind segment consists of Onshore Wind, Offshore Wind and LM Wind, and the Electrification segment consists of Grid Solutions, Power Conversion, Electrification Software and Solar & Storage Solutions.
